About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Assist attorneys with litigation case management from intake through resolution. ⚖️
  • Draft, review, and organize legal documents, pleadings, motions, and correspondence. 📝
  • Manage case files, deadlines, court calendars, and litigation schedules. 📅
  • Conduct legal research and gather supporting documentation for active cases. 🔍
  • Communicate with clients, opposing counsel, courts, and third parties in English and Spanish. 🗣️
  • Prepare discovery materials, document productions, and case summaries. 📂
  • File legal documents electronically and maintain accurate case records. 💻
  • Answer and route phone calls professionally while providing case updates when appropriate. 📞
